Forums » Utilisation d'AMC (french) »
Annotation des réponses --verdict-question
Added by Eric Le Gallais over 12 years ago
Bonjour,
il semblerait que le manpage de AMC-annote ne parle pas de l'option --verdict-question.
J'aimerais bien savoir comment cette option fonctionne.
Présentement j'utilise --verdict-question "$S/$M" et l'annotation est très curieuse.
Au passage, quel est le code à utiliser pour ajouter un CR dans l'option --verdict?
Replies (1)
RE: Annotation des réponses --verdict-question
-
Added by Alexis Bienvenüe over 12 years ago
J'aimerais bien savoir comment cette option fonctionne.
- Il faut utiliser la syntaxe
%s
et%m
au lieu de$S
et$M
, ou bien%S
et%M
(la différence est juste que la version avec minuscules est tronquée à un certain nombre de chiffres significatifs, donné en argument grâce à--ch-sign
). - L'argument est évalué par perl, il faut donc entourer une chaîne de caractères avec des guillemets :
--verdict-question "\"%s/%m\""
Ceci permet de faire des annotations mettant en jeu des tests, comme--verdict-question "(%s==%m ? \"Acquis\" : \"X\")"
qui écrit Acquis si le score est le score maximal, et X sinon.
Au passage, quel est le code à utiliser pour ajouter un CR dans l'option --verdict?
Dans un shell classique, on peut utiliser \n
pour insérer un passage à la ligne à l'intérieur d'une chaîne délimitée par des guillemets "
.
(1-1/1)